+ def test_namespace_interaction_with_select_and_find(self):
+ # Demonstrate how namespaces interact with select* and
+ # find* methods.
+
+ soup = self.soup(
+ '<?xml version="1.1"?>\n'
+ '<root>'
+ '<tag xmlns="http://unprefixed-namespace.com">content</tag>'
+ '<prefix:tag2 xmlns:prefix="http://prefixed-namespace.com">content</tag>'
+ '<subtag xmlns:prefix="http://another-namespace-same-prefix.com">'
+ '<prefix:tag3>'
+ '</subtag>'
+ '</root>'
)
+
+ # soupselect uses namespace URIs.
+ assert soup.select_one('tag').name == 'tag'
+ assert soup.select_one('prefix|tag2').name == 'tag2'
+
+ # If a prefix is declared more than once, only the first usage
+ # is registered with the BeautifulSoup object.
+ assert soup.select_one('prefix|tag3') is None
+
+ # But you can always explicitly specify a namespace dictionary.
+ assert soup.select_one(
+ 'prefix|tag3', namespaces=soup.subtag._namespaces
+ ).name == 'tag3'
+
+ # And a Tag (as opposed to the BeautifulSoup object) will
+ # have a set of default namespaces scoped to that Tag.
+ assert soup.subtag.select_one('prefix|tag3').name=='tag3'
+
+ # the find() methods aren't fully namespace-aware; they just
+ # look at prefixes.
+ assert soup.find('tag').name == 'tag'
+ assert soup.find('prefix:tag2').name == 'tag2'
+ assert soup.find('prefix:tag3').name == 'tag3'
+ assert soup.subtag.find('prefix:tag3').name == 'tag3'
